Who might be able to join this trial:

  • Adults aged 18 or older who have served, or are currently serving, in the military.
  • People who have been formally diagnosed with PTSD through a structured clinical interview called the CAPS-5 (a standardised assessment used by clinicians to diagnose PTSD).

Who may not be able to join:

  • People who are experiencing active psychosis (a loss of touch with reality) or dementia at the time of screening.
  • People who are currently having thoughts of suicide with a clear intention to act on them.
  • People who are already enrolled in another clinical trial for PTSD or depression.
  • People who have a substance use disorder.
  • People with vision problems that would prevent use of an augmented reality (AR) headset — however, people whose vision is corrected with contact lenses may still be eligible, as contacts can be worn under the headset. For those who cannot wear contacts, a mild prescription of no stronger than -2.00 diopters may still be acceptable (confirm with trial site).
